This well-appointed Nashville, Illinois hotel offers direct access to outdoor recreational activities and is 45 miles from St. Louis International Airport.
Situated in the heartland of Illinois, the BEST WESTERN U.S. Inn is 10 miles from the Washington County Conservation Area. Visitors have easy access to outdoor recreational activities including hunting, fishing, camping, hiking and boating.
After a long day outdoors, unwind at the comfortable BEST WESTERN U.S. Inn. Guests of this cozy Illinois Inn enjoy a daily complimentary continental breakfast, high-speed Internet access and swimming in the outdoor pool. The inn is located steps from Little Nashville Restaurant and blocks from McDonald's.
Visitors are also three miles from Nashville Park, 10 miles from a public golf course and 15 miles from fishing, hunting and trapping, sailing, golfing, swimming and camping at scenic Carlyle Lake.
